SmallForce is an AI operations platform for agencies and small businesses. Your AI employees can work with your business knowledge, use connected services, communicate through the channels you already use, and complete work across websites, marketing, advertising, calls, meetings, media, and research.

Work from anywhere
Use SmallForce from the web, desktop, and mobile apps, from Apple Watch, or through Slack and Telegram. The surface can change without changing the employee or the business context available to it.

Automate with the CLI
The public SmallForce CLI is designed for both people and agents. Its generated command reference documents the exact syntax, flags, defaults, examples, and subcommands shipped in the current CLI.
